The Future of "The Equalizer": Queen Latifah Reflects on a Groundbreaking Series

For many fans of CBS, the cancellation of The Equalizer felt abrupt and disappointing. Queen Latifah, the star of the show, recently shared her thoughts on the end of the series, highlighting her gratitude and pride in the work produced during its five seasons.

A Personal Touch

In a candid conversation with Us Weekly, Latifah opened up about the emotional impact of the show’s cancellation. “It is a little out of my hands in terms of what happens with it from this point forward,” she explained, acknowledging the limitations of her control over the show’s fate. Despite this, she expressed immense appreciation for the journey: “I’m processing [the cancellation]. It occurred to me that it has been such a big part of my life for the last — more than — five years actually. I’m thankful. I’m very grateful.”

Celebrating Success and Acknowledging Challenges

Reflecting on her experience, Latifah expressed pride in the series’ accomplishments, emphasizing the collaborative effort that brought The Equalizer to life. “I appreciate CBS putting us on and my producing partners and the wonderful cast I got to work with,” she said, emphasizing the familial bond formed with her crew. However, she also addressed the challenges faced, including scheduling conflicts that often shifted the show’s airtime, leading to confusion among fans.

Fan Engagement and Public Demand

Latifah recounted the urgency from fans who were eager to see the show continue. She humorously shared her encounters where fans would approach her, expressing their frustration: “Where is my show?” she laughed, noting that while some were playful, the demand showcased the show’s dedicated following. “I’m tired of getting rolled up on because sometimes they choose violence when they want their show. I’m just kidding.”

Storylines and Themes

Based on a beloved series, The Equalizer debuted in 2021 and centered on Latifah’s character—a woman with a mysterious background who helps those in need. The show’s diverse themes resonated with many, touching on love, family, and the complexities of human connection. Latifah fondly reflected on the motivations behind creating the show, particularly in wanting to cater to different demographics, including her grandmother who cherished the action-packed sequences.

Viewership and Streaming Options

As fans grapple with the show’s cancellation, they still have the option to binge-watch the 72 episodes available on platforms like Netflix. Latifah encouraged her audience to continue engaging with the series and its message, expressing gratitude for their support: “I appreciate everyone that tuned in to watch it.”

Looking Ahead

Though The Equalizer has reached its conclusion, Latifah is optimistic about the future. “I am onto the next one. There will be a lot more to come,” she assured her fans, hinting at new projects, both for herself and her talented cast.

Advocacy and Health Awareness

Outside of her acting career, Latifah is currently partnering with Novo Nordisk to raise awareness about obesity and related cardiovascular risks. “Obesity is a disease and many people are living with it. It impacts 2 out of 5 Americans,” she noted. Highlighting the importance of education and resources, she directed fans to the website TruthAboutWeight.com for more information.

Through her advocacy, Latifah continues to make an impact, bridging her artistic pursuits with meaningful health conversations.
